## v2.9.0 — Changed Defaults

The VramScope profiler now samples allocation events every 50 ms instead of 200 ms, and peak-memory tracking is enabled by default. Maintainers upgrading existing deployments should note that historical baselines captured at the old interval are not comparable. After upgrading, initialize the profiler daemon with the following configuration values.

deployment values, faduf-tawep:
SORDOR_LOG_LEVEL=error
SORDOR_METRICS_HOST=metrics.sordor.nelvrolabs.internal
SORDOR_POOL_SIZE=4

Hey — handing off the Userbreak split before I'm out. The extraction of the user module from the Tollwick monolith is about 80% done; auth callbacks still route through the old service. Don't merge anything touching session handling until Priya's shim lands. The new service boots fine in staging with overrides. For review, here's the exact config the split service starts with.

deployment values, yadup-kadug:
[sorys]
port = 5672
team = noveth
host = sorys.orvexcorp.example
region = south-4
access_code = ac_deddc1
timeout_ms = 1500

Before co-signing, confirm the Routewise heuristic module hash matches the ledger entry from the Marberly ceremony log. Check that the proximity-weighting constants were not altered after the freeze; any diff blocks the ceremony. Reviewer and custodian must both initial the printed manifest. Do not approve if the heuristic's tie-break logic references the deprecated zone table. Once both signatures are collected, unseal the ceremony envelope using the recovery passphrase below.

unlock words, tawif-tahop: oliys-ulawyn-tamdor-lamys-casox-jormir-fraius-kasath-ulador-ulamir-holir-sorys-holeth

### Runbook: BounceBroom — Account Recovery

If the BounceBroom email bounce processor loses access to its service account, do not create a new one. First, pause the intake queue so bounces buffer safely. Then open the recovery console and select the BounceBroom principal. Verification requires approval from the on-call lead. Once approved, the console prompts for the stored recovery credentials; enter the passphrase that appears directly below this paragraph.

recovery phrase for fahof-kahap: holion-gormir-jorix-istix-briwyn-sorael